Kidnap Kingpin, Receive N4m Ransom From Own Father Meets Waterloo In Kogi

By Noah Ocheni, Lokoja

The Kogi State security operatives in Olamaboro Local Government Area of Kogi State over the weekend killed a kidnap kingpin in a gun duel.

The deceased criminal was known for his numerous ventures of kidnapping and armed robbery and
was once reported to have kidnapped his own farther and collected a ransom of 4 million naira.

It was reliably gathered that he was always in the eyes of the law enforcement agency but met his waterloo when encountered by security operatives in the area on Saturday.

Our correspondent gathered that a combined operation led by Olamaboro Local Government Chairman, Hon. Adejoh Friday Nicodemus involving both teams from the neighborhood nabbed another kidnap agent identified as Kizito Ocheme alias Igbo.

The culprit kidnapped and terrorized between Olamaboro Local government and Otukpa branch of Ogbadibo Local government of Beñnue State but was apprehended while trying to escape from the security operatives in the area.

The Local Government Chairman, Hon Adejoh Friday stated that the efforts of Governor Yahaya Bello and the entire leadership of Kogi State Government to guarantee the safety of lives and property is yielding good results as criminals now find Kogi as a no-go area.

In his reaction, Governor Bello who spoke through his Chief Press Secretary, Onogwu Muhammed expressed that the Local Government were the framework upon which the government structure was laid hence if issues of security were resolved effectively at that level, it would reflect positively on the state.

He stated that the results they were recording were largely owed to the morale boost and support the Governor has continued to give as well as the cooperation from the citizens and synergy between the security operatives and commended security agencies in the state for their effort in ensuring peace in the state.

As at the time of filling in the report, the Police Public Relations Officer (PPRO) of the Kogi Police Command, DSP. William Aya, could not be reached through his mobile Phone.
